Khadta Population - Jammu, Jammu and Kashmir
Khadta is a medium size village located in Jammu Tehsil of Jammu district, Jammu and Kashmir with total 193 families residing. The Khadta village has population of 1035 of which 546 are males while 489 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Khadta village population of children with age 0-6 is 146 which makes up 14.11 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Khadta village is 896 which is higher than Jammu and Kashmir state average of 889. Child Sex Ratio for the Khadta as per census is 587, lower than Jammu and Kashmir average of 862.
Khadta village has higher literacy rate compared to Jammu and Kashmir. In 2011, literacy rate of Khadta village was 76.04 % compared to 67.16 % of Jammu and Kashmir. In Khadta Male literacy stands at 83.48 % while female literacy rate was 68.28 %.

Khadta Data
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total No. of Houses | 193 | - | - |
Population | 1,035 | 546 | 489 |
Child (0-6) | 146 | 92 | 54 |
Schedule Caste | 209 | 108 | 101 |
Schedule Tribe | 39 | 24 | 15 |
Literacy | 76.04 % | 83.48 % | 68.28 % |
Total Workers | 436 | 248 | 188 |
Main Worker | 357 | - | - |
Marginal Worker | 79 | 1 | 78 |
